How to Prepare for Different Weather Conditions

Preparing for different weather conditions in the Philippines requires a proactive approach, tailored to the specific threats posed by each type of event. For instance, when it comes to typhoons, you'll want to begin by securing your home. Make sure your roof is in good condition, reinforce your windows and doors, and trim any trees near your property that could fall during strong winds. Then, stockpile essential supplies. Gather non-perishable food items, water, a first-aid kit, flashlights, batteries, and a radio. Also, ensure you have important documents, such as your identification and insurance policies, in a waterproof container. Identify your evacuation route and designated shelter. Know where you'll go if you're forced to evacuate and have a plan for how you'll get there. If heavy rains and flooding are predicted, be sure to clear your drainage systems. Clean your gutters, downspouts, and any other areas where water can accumulate. Elevate your valuables. If you live in a flood-prone area, move your electronics and other valuable items to higher ground. Monitor the water levels and be ready to evacuate if necessary. In the event of extreme heat, take precautions to avoid heatstroke and dehydration. Stay hydrated by drinking plenty of water, and wear lightweight, light-colored clothing. Limit outdoor activities during the hottest parts of the day and seek shade whenever possible. For earthquakes, know how to protect yourself. During an earthquake, drop, cover, and hold on. Get under a sturdy table or desk and hold on to it until the shaking stops. Be aware of potential hazards such as falling objects and broken glass. What are the PAGASA public storm warning signals? The PAGASA public storm warning signals indicate the level of threat posed by an approaching typhoon. Signal No. 1 means that winds of 30-60 kilometers per hour are expected in the next 36 hours. Signal No. 2 indicates winds of 61-120 kilometers per hour. Signal No. 3 means winds of 121-170 kilometers per hour, and Signal No. 4 means winds of more than 170 kilometers per hour. These signals guide the public on necessary safety measures.
